Comprehensive Guide to Mechanical Permit

What is the Mechanical Permit Application?

The Mechanical Permit Application is a crucial form in Gaffney, SC, serving as a vital component of the contractor permitting process for mechanical work. This application defines the necessary steps that contractors must take to ensure compliance with local regulations. The form streamlines the permitting experience by clarifying the roles of all parties involved, thereby protecting both property owners and contractors throughout the process.

Purpose and Benefits of the Mechanical Permit Application

This application is essential for contractors to guarantee adherence to local laws and standards. By using the Mechanical Permit Application, contractors outline the scope of work clearly, which prevents misunderstandings and protects their interests as well as those of property owners. This promotes transparency and accountability, making the permitting process smoother and more efficient.

Who Needs the Mechanical Permit Application?

The Mechanical Permit Application is designed for licensed contractors operating within Gaffney, SC. Those who qualify must be responsible for various types of mechanical work, including HVAC installations, plumbing modifications, and other specialized mechanical tasks. Understanding which jobs require this permit ensures that contractors remain compliant and avoid delays in project execution.

How to Fill Out the Mechanical Permit Application Online

Completing the Mechanical Permit Application online is straightforward. Here are the essential fields you need to fill out:
  • Contact information of the contractor
  • Details about the property where work will occur
  • A thorough description of the planned mechanical work
To ensure accuracy, contractors should double-check their entries to avoid common errors, such as missing signatures or incorrect job valuations.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ials

When submitting your application, it is important to include necessary supporting documents. The following papers are generally required:
  • Property deed
  • Proof of insurance
  • Documentation for fee calculation based on the job valuation
Having these documents ready will help facilitate a smoother application process.

Fees, Processing Time, and Payment Methods

Understanding the financial responsibilities associated with the Mechanical Permit Application is critical. Permit fees depend on the project's overall estimated cost, and payment methods may include checks, credit cards, or electronic payments. Typical processing times for applications in Gaffney can vary, so contractors should plan accordingly to avoid project delays.

Submission Process for the Mechanical Permit Application

Submitting the Mechanical Permit Application can be done either online or in person, depending on the contractor's preference.
  • Follow the online submission steps on the designated city portal.
  • If submitting in person, visit the local permitting office and ensure you have all required documentation.
After submission, you will receive a confirmation, which is crucial for tracking the application's status.

Tracking Your Application Status

Contractors can easily track the status of their Mechanical Permit Application through the city's permitting portal. Methods for verifying the application process include online status checks and direct contact with permitting officials. Should any issues arise, guidance is available on how to address and remedy concerns efficiently.

Common Issues with the Mechanical Permit Application

While completing the Mechanical Permit Application, contractors may encounter several common issues. These often include:
  • Incomplete forms
  • Missing supporting documents
If an application is rejected, it is vital to understand the reasons and take appropriate steps to amend or re-submit the application accurately.
